dRuby/DRb
参考:
module function DRb.#start_service (Ruby 2.5.0)
module function DRb.#stop_service (Ruby 2.5.0)
class DRb::DRbObject (Ruby 2.5.0)
概要
参考:
実世界での dRuby の使用例 – GitHub Gist
使い方
参考:
Hello, dRuby | m-kawato@hatena_diary
分散オブジェクトシステム drb を利用する | Ruby Tips!
Ruby で分散オブジェクト (dRuby) | Netsphere Laboratories
dRuby を使った、分散オブジェクトによる別プロセスの呼び出し | Developers.IO
DRb.start_service
参考:
druby コラム DRb.start_service のなぞ (4.1.3 どちらがサーバでどちらがクライアント?) – GitHub Gist
drb/unix
require "drb/unix" say = "hello" DRb.start_service("drbunix:/tmp/hoge", say)
参考:
DRb::DRbConnError
参考:
DRb::DRbConnError connection closed のエラーについて – Qiita
セキュリティモデル
レベル 0
デフォルトのセーフレベルです。
レベル 1
信用しているプログラムで信用できないデータを処理する為のレベルです。 CGI等でユーザからの入力を処理するのに適しています。
参考:
How to check if DRb server is alive
参考: